Slow Speeds

!Note! Before running any speed test, disable any antivirus and firewalls that you may have. These can severly slow down your internet connection.

A slow internet connection can be caused by a variety of issues. The first thing you should do is confirm that you are receiving the speed that you are paying for.

You can check this by running our speed test located here. Your "download" should be roughly the speed you are paying for. For example, if your download is 986 kbps and your upload is 486 that is roughly our 1Mb/s service.

Due to the nature of the technology that is being used, the speed given through the speed test will rarely reflect the actual speed that you are paying for.

If, however, your speed is considerably less that what you are paying for, then the most likely cause is that you have multiple computers connected through a router or your computer is affected with spyware/virus.

The next thing to do is, if you have a router, connect a computer directly to the cable modem and re-run the speed test.

If you are still getting the same speed please run an antivirus/antispyware program. You can find links these software in our Support section. Click here to go there now.

If none of these resolves your issue please contact BCI Support. It is possible, however rare, that their is noise on your cable line. Click here to visit our Contact section.
